Registration for TradMad Camp is open!

TradMaD is FMSNY’s summer six-day gathering for adults interested in traditional music and dance in at the beautiful and historic Pinewoods Camp in Plymouth, Massachusetts. Read about our wonderful staff here, learn more about life at camp here, and register here.

The Folk Music Society of New York is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ization dedicated to providing opportunities to enjoy, learn about, and make folk music of all kinds. We produce and co-sponsor events in and around New York City, from weekend festivals to individual concerts, workshops, and singing sessions.
